Town of Black Mountain

Closed
160 Midland Ave
Black Mountain, NC 28711

The Town of Black Mountain, located in North Carolina, is dedicated to providing essential services and resources to its residents and visitors. The town actively engages the community through various initiatives, including budget proposals, public meetings, and notifications about local events and services.

Generated from the website

Own this business?
See a problem?

You might also like

United StatesNorth CarolinaBlack MountainTown of Black Mountain